A weekly theme is reflected in the prayers, music, poetry and selections from world religions and various sources. All are encouraged to contribute inspirational pieces. This Sunday, June 7, our theme is faith.

The Baha’I Faith is a world religion whose purpose is to unite all people of the world in one universal cause, one common faith.

“And now I give you a commandment which shall be for a covenant between you and me — that ye have faith; that your faith be steadfast as a rock that no storms can move, that nothing can disturb, and that it endure through all things even to the end …

“As ye have faith, so shall your powers and blessings be.” — Abdu’l Baha.
